IELTS Writing Task 2 question

Some people think that it’s a good idea to socialise with work colleagues during evenings and weekends. Other people think it’s important to keep working life completely separate from social life.

Discuss both these views and give your own opinion.

Give reasons for your answer and include any relevant examples from your own knowledge or experience.

Task Achievement / Task Response — Band 5.5

The response addresses both sides of the argument and provides a personal opinion, meeting the basic requirements of the prompt. However, the development of ideas is somewhat limited. For instance, the argument regarding the benefits of socializing is supported by the idea of 'better understandings,' but this is not fully explored with concrete examples. Similarly, the counter-argument about maintaining a separate personal life is a bit repetitive and lacks depth. To improve, you should aim to expand your points with more specific, illustrative examples rather than relying on general statements. Your position is clear, but the overall development remains at a basic level.

Coherence and Cohesion — Band 6.0

The essay is organized into clear paragraphs, which helps the reader follow the structure. You use some cohesive devices like 'To start with,' 'However,' and 'In conclusion,' which provide a basic framework. However, the flow between sentences is sometimes mechanical, and the use of referencing is occasionally unclear (e.g., 'It is good idea so that they can gather...'). The progression of ideas within paragraphs could be smoother; some sentences feel disjointed. To reach a higher band, focus on using a wider variety of linking words and ensuring that each sentence logically follows the previous one to create a more cohesive argument.

Lexical Resource — Band 5.5

The vocabulary used is adequate for the task but lacks the range and precision required for higher bands. You rely on basic, repetitive phrasing such as 'good idea' and 'working life.' There are also some issues with word choice and collocation, such as 'being socializing' (should be 'socializing') and 'attentions' (should be 'intentions'). While the meaning is generally clear, the lack of more sophisticated or topic-specific vocabulary limits the score. To improve, try to incorporate more varied synonyms and precise collocations related to professional and social dynamics.

Grammatical Range and Accuracy — Band 5.5

The essay contains a mix of simple and some complex sentence structures, but there are frequent grammatical errors that occasionally impede the flow. Common issues include subject-verb agreement (e.g., 'being socializing... are good idea'), missing articles, and awkward phrasing (e.g., 'they can take wrong way'). While these errors do not completely prevent understanding, they are persistent throughout the text. To improve, focus on mastering basic sentence construction, particularly subject-verb agreement and the correct use of articles, before attempting more complex structures.
